| Architectural and Transportation Barriers Compliance Board |
| The Access Board is the federal agency responsible for writing the architectural guidelines for the Americans with Disabilities Act, as well as for other regulations dealing with accessibility. |

Civil Rights Division
Access Compliance |
| The Department of Justice enforces Title III of the ADA, which governs access to privately owned facilities open to the public. Most enforcement has been through mediation and negotiation. The DOJ sometimes issues interpretations to ADAAG. |

| American National Standards Institute A117.1 Committee |
| This committee writes the standards for accessibility which are used by government agencies and code writing bodies. The most recent edition was published in 2009, and the Committee will next meet to produce the 2015 standard. The sign standards have been completely revised since 1992, and form the basis for the 2004 guidelines of the Access Board. |
